Agrippa. Died 12 BC. Æ As (29mm, 9.14 g, 6h). Rome mint. Struck under Gaius (Caligula), AD 37-41. Head left, wearing rostral crown / Neptune standing left, holding small dolphin and trident. RIC I 58 (Gaius). Good Fine, green and brown patina, porosity and areas of corrosion.
